
SoundCloud is rolling out a new way for its musician users to make money from their uploads. The company has partnered with Getty Images Music to add ‘license’ buttons to its player and widget, which would-be licensees can click to send a request. Users have to own all the rights for the music they intend to license, and will also need to connect their SoundCloud accounts to Getty Images Music, and be approved by the latter. Getty will handle sales and marketing for the content, taking 65% of any sync licensing revenue, with the artist taking a 35% payout.
